Suzuki Music Time is our music and singing class for 0-3 year olds and their parents. It’s a wonderful way to prepare yourself and your child for the Suzuki journey of learning an instrument later on. SMT happens at the Hub at 9.45am and 11am each Thursday morning. The classes last for around one hour and are £16 each and there are discounts available for low-income families.

If your child is 3 years old you can choose between SMT and Music Mind Games. The Music Mind Games classes are 35 minutes long and require more focused concentration than SMT but are still loads of fun, with lots of singing and general musicianship, as well as some stave work and exposure to rhythm and pulse. These classes cost £14 each and there are discounts available for low-income families. The children in these groups are aged 3 to 5 years old.

Our Thursday Suzuki Music Time classes are run by trained Suzuki Early Childhood Education teacher Hannah, who is also a Suzuki violin teacher. Our Saturday Music Mind Games classes are led by Naomi, who also conducts one of our Suzuki Hub orchestras. Hannah and Naomi lead the group of children and parents through a fast-paced musical curriculum, reciting nursery rhymes, singing, playing high quality musical instruments, dancing, marching in time, twirling, counting, leading, taking turns, listening and reading. The classes are similar - the Thursday classes follow the official Suzuki Early Childhood Education syllabus while our Saturday classes are Naomi’s own unique blend of various approaches to toddler music and singing.

The Suzuki Music Time programme develops musical, cognitive, social and motor skills including an understanding of dynamics, pitch, rhythm and pulse, greater numeracy and vocabulary, group sensitivity, confidence in communicating, and a love of learning. It’s also a great way for parent and child to prepare for when they start learning an instrument together once the child turns four years old.
